Inger S. Enger
Inger S. Enger (born July 6, 1948 in Trøgstad) is a Norwegian politician for the Centre Party (SP). She was elected to the Norwegian Parliament from Oppland in 2001.
Previously she was mayor of Gausdal municipality from 1994-2001 (deputy mayor 1991-94). She is the sister of Anne Enger Lahnstein.
